Additional Information
 
PublicationJanuary 1951 | Price: 0.10 USD | Pages: 1 | Frequency: Monthly
 
FeaturingCrimebuster
CreditsPencils: Charles Biro | Inks: Charles Biro
 
Comic StoryThe Death Chase (13 pages)
FeaturingCrimebuster
CreditsScript: Charles Biro | Pencils: Norman Maurer | Inks: Norman Maurer
ContentCharacters: Crimebuster (origin retold in flashback); Iron Jaw (villain; origin retold in flashback); Adolph Hitler (villain; flashback); Rodent (flashback)
 
PSAThe Classroom Secret (1 page)
CreditsPencils: Jerry Fasano (signed) | Inks: Jerry Fasano (signed) | Letters: typeset
ContentGenre: Advocacy
Notespublic school promo
 
Text StoryThe Little "Sahib (2 pages)
FeaturingDaredevil; Little Wise Guys
CreditsLetters: typeset
ContentGenre: Adventure | Characters: Daredevil [Bart Hill]
 
Comic StoryAlias "Scoop Duncan" (7 pages)
FeaturingDilly Duncan
CreditsPencils: Ben Brown? | Inks: Ben Brown?
ContentGenre: Teen | Characters: Dilly Duncan
 
Comic StoryIron Jaw's Escape to Conquer! (16 pages)
FeaturingCrimebuster
CreditsScript: Charles Biro | Pencils: Norman Maurer? | Inks: Norman Maurer?
ContentGenre: Superhero | Characters: Crimebuster; Iron Jaw (villain); Number One [Krepla Rooblik] (first appearance; villain)
